Published Work

The stone steps pf the Roman Arena in Arles, France.

Short Stories

"Canary Girl", published in the anthology, FEISTY DEEDS: Historical Fictions of Daring Women, 2024


"An Uncertain Justice" The Westchester Review


"Shooting Stars in the Skies over the Somme, August 1916" Literally Stories

 

“An Italian Affair” Shotgun Honey


"History Lessons" Bards and Sages Quarterly, July 2021


•"Close Calls" Bards and Sages Quarterly, January 2019


•"Her Mother's Ring" published in the The Love Dust Anthology 2018


Flash Fiction

"No one found it curious that Grandfather left without his oil paints" Killer Nashville Magazine

 

“The Heart Burns” New Feathers Anthology


“Resurrection” Retreats From Oblivion Journal of Noircon


"A summer of sorrows, 1847" National Flash Fiction Day 2020 Anthology 


"Faerie Coffins" FlashBack Fiction


"Upgrading to Motherhood 2.0" Mojave River Review 


"The Boys of Summer: A Playlist" Milk Candy Review


"This is how she finds life" Mojave River Review 


Poetry

"Rhythm Method", The Meadow


"Their Horizons Lost in the Dustbowl" and "Girls Have It Easy", Brushfire Literature & Arts Journal,Ed. 69, Vol. 1


"It's Election Night and I hear the voice of the people"/"Paradise (Still) Lost"/"Gleaning", Tracks: The Piedmont Journal of Poetry & Fiction 2014-2018


"Work in Progress" and "Late Night Radio", The Magnolia Review, Vol. 2, Issue 2
